Richmond Va. January 28th/67
Howard Major General, O.O.
Commissioner.

General.
I have the honor to transmit herewith, an estimate of rations required for issued to destitute "Refugees" and "Freedmen", in this Department, during the month of February 1867, for approval.

I am, General 
Very Respectfully
Your Obt. Servt.
(Signed) J.M. Schofield
Bvt. Maj. Genl. U.S.A.
Asst. Comr.

Official
Garrick Mallery
A.A.A.G. 

(1 Enclosure)
 
Estimate of rations required for issue to "Sick in Hospitals", and to destitute "Refugees and Freedmen", in the Department of the Potomac, for the month of February 1867.
 
Number of Rations required. Sixty three thousand (63.000).
